Extreme exercise calls for a simple, results-driven skincare routine. And no other group can appreciate this more than professional athletes.

“I expose my skin to wind, sun, chlorine, ocean, rain, pretty much everything!” Says Anna Cleaver, a triathlete from Greenville South Carolina, who is a huge fan of Dr. Lisa Kellett’s 4-step Clear Skincare Regimen Kit ($220, kellettskincare.com), designed to battle adult acne and fine lines.

According to Cleaver, “Many female triathletes, cyclists, runners and swimmers have breakouts, dryness, and irritated skin due to the nature of what we do. We are continuously applying sunscreen, which with many products seems to sweat right off. The sport is not kind to our skin.”

Cleaver has been using the Clear system for four months now and says that it has normalized her oily, irritated skin. No longer does she get the post-workout breakouts she associated with excessive sweating and sunscreen use. “The changes in my skin’s appearance and feel since using the Kellett Skincare range are dramatic. I no longer get irritated or inflamed skin after exposure to sun, chlorine, sweat. The range has reduced breakouts and improved pigmentation.”

The 4-step Clear kit consists of a gentle exfoliating cleanser, a gel moisturizer for day and night time use, a spray sunscreen with SPF 30, and a 5% benzoyl peroxide-based acne treatment cream.

“It is a simple skincare program that has an impact extremely quickly. I think it is a fantastic range for athletes. Dr. Kellett even produces a great sunscreen that does not sweat off!”

A typical day for Cleaver involves waking up at the crack of dawn to train, all day long, and then spending the evenings at home working on various sponsored-based projects. Right now, she’s working with Hincapie Sportswear on hosting several upcoming triathlon training events, as well as, putting together swimming programs with Team Kattouf at swim clinics across the Carolinas.

For this rising star who had humble beginnings in the sport – Cleaver taught herself how to swim at age 6, and quit her cushy corporate finance job in her late twenties to compete professionally in the U.S., – juggling it all is something that she feels she hasn’t yet mastered. “I am not sure I have achieved the balanced life I desire yet, but I am always striving to. I believe in having more than one goal or focus. Sport is a big part of my life. But an injury or bout of illness can take this away very quickly. For me, it is therefore important to have multiple goals and sources of happiness.”

The Skiny on Anna Cleaver

Birth Place: New Zealand

Age: 32

Skin type: Normal to dry

Humble beginnings: “I borrowed a friend’s bike, really having no clue what I was doing. I qualified for the New Zealand Pro Tour in that first race.”

Recent win: Placed 7th in her first Ironman in 2013 and won an Olympic distance race.

Bed-to-bed schedule: Swim practice (7 to 9 A.M.), cycle for 3- 5 hours, hit the gym or a light run in the late afternoon, sponsor duties in the evening.

Diet: “I eat very simple clean food, very rarely do I open a packet to eat.”
